Bakersfield brewery serving beer to benefit Camp Fire victims

Posted
and last updated

BAKERSFIELD, Calif. — A Bakersfield brewery is serving a beer in order to help victims of the Camp Fire.

Temblor Brewing Company is releasing Resilience IPA to help those in Butte County who have been impacted by the Camp Fire. 100% of the proceeds from the beer will go to the Sierra Nevada Camp Fire Relief Fund.

Visitors can pick up a pint, crowler, or growler of Resilience IPA at Temblor Brewing Company tomorrow, December 20.
